Ecosyste.ms: Awesome
An open API service indexing awesome lists of open source software.
Socket.IO
![](https://explore-feed.github.com/topics/socket-io/socket-io.png)
Socket.IO is a JavaScript library for realtime web applications. It enables realtime, bi-directional communication between web clients and servers. It has two parts: a client-side library that runs in the browser, and a server-side library for Node.js. Both components have a nearly identical API. Like Node.js, it is event-driven.
- GitHub: https://github.com/topics/socket-io
- Wikipedia: https://en.wikipedia.org/wiki/Socket.IO
- Repo: https://github.com/socketio/socket.io
- Released: March 19, 2010
- Related Topics: nodejs,
- Last updated: 2025-02-11 00:28:09 UTC
- JSON Representation
https://github.com/developerdiyorbek/telegram-clone
Telegram clone app
expressjs nextjs shadcn-ui socket-io
Last synced: 06 Feb 2025
https://github.com/wilsonibekason/stream_chat
This is a stream chat where users can create channels, chat, reply, add photos, emoji's, videos, add hash tags
react socket-io stream typescript
Last synced: 15 Jan 2025
https://github.com/rahgurung/coo
coo: open chatrooms web app build with flask which is open source
css flask javascript messaging python3 socket-io
Last synced: 05 Feb 2025
https://github.com/menoc61/mybox
This is a project for a fully functional e-commerce plateform for cameroon
mern-stack reactjs redux socket-io tailwind-css
Last synced: 10 Jan 2025
https://github.com/anjali-001/peek
Peek is a video-conferencing web app.
javascript nodejs peerjs socket-io webrtc
Last synced: 04 Jan 2025
https://github.com/lpjjj1222/real-time-chatapp
A chat app with user authentication, online user status, and instant messaging.
jwt-token mern-stack socket-io
Last synced: 11 Jan 2025
https://github.com/j0m1ty/nettd
A Unity multiplayer tower defence game, made with hexagons in mind
hexagonal-grids socket-io tower-defense unity3d
Last synced: 08 Feb 2025
https://github.com/theanujdev/webrtc-video-call
Connect peer-to-peer using WebRTC to users via video call
express nodejs socket-io webrtc webrtc-demos webrtc-video
Last synced: 16 Jan 2025
https://github.com/anonymerniklasistanonym/marktex
Webserver for viewing, editing and exporting of Markdown files with LaTeX sections
docker express inkscape latex markdown markdown-it mocha-chai nodejs pandoc socket-io sqlite3 typescript webpack
Last synced: 22 Dec 2024
https://github.com/abhishek-ranjan-16/chattuapp
Used for chatting
chakra-ui css express html javascript material-ui mongodb node react-js socket-io
Last synced: 17 Jan 2025
https://github.com/rendy752/discord-clone
A Discord Clone that includes chat features, text, voice, video channels, user authentication using Clerk, and web socket for real-time chat
axios clerk clsx emoji-picker eslint livekit lucide-react nextjs14 prisma query-string radix-ui socket-io socket-io-client tailwind tanstack-react-query typescript uploadthing websocket zod
Last synced: 04 Jan 2025
https://github.com/oghene-ella/mini_chat_app
A mini chat app using Socket.io
Last synced: 11 Jan 2025
https://github.com/kirtanp04/mern-chat-app-frontend
https://kirtanp04-chat-app.netlify.app/
Last synced: 06 Feb 2025
https://github.com/serkanisyapan/knucklebones
Multiplayer version of the minigame from Cult of the Lamb
astro game multiplayer reactjs socket-io
Last synced: 07 Feb 2025
https://github.com/veoscript/rekados-api
API for Rekados App using ExpressJS and Prisma. Applicable for Web, Mobile and Desktop Applications
expressjs iron-session prisma render rest-api socket-io
Last synced: 01 Jan 2025
https://github.com/huynhtruong01/news-it-dev
News IT helps everyone want to study, improve your knowleage about new technology, new programming languages, framework,...
axios muiv5 mysql nodejs react react-quill socket-io typeorm typescript
Last synced: 24 Jan 2025
https://github.com/muttakinhasib/afkin
Monorepo for Afkin - Social Media Application
chat-app expo monorepo nestjs nx react-native socket-io
Last synced: 24 Jan 2025
https://github.com/aleksanderpalamar/mobile-app
Aplicação frontend e backend desenvolvida durante o evento NLW Heat na trilha impulse da Rockeseat.
expo nlw-heat react-native reactjs rocketseat socket-io typescript
Last synced: 28 Jan 2025
https://github.com/umarhadi/socketio-chat
Real Time chat Menggunakan Socket.Io, HTML dan JavaScript
chat-application javascript realtime-chat socket-io
Last synced: 22 Dec 2024
https://github.com/baxsm/draw-together-nextjs
Draw Together: A collaborative platform for sharing moments of creativity and fun!
nextjs shadcn-ui socket-io tailwindcss typescript
Last synced: 07 Feb 2025
https://github.com/zzzzhhhn/tetris
俄罗斯方块游戏 typescript + socket.io + gulp
gulp socket-io tetris typescript webpack2
Last synced: 11 Jan 2025
https://github.com/stefanwille/chat-react-material-ui-node
A chat based on React.js, Material-UI, Socket.io, Express and Node.js
material-ui nodejs reactjs socket-io
Last synced: 05 Feb 2025
https://github.com/szokeasaurusrex/resistance
Online multiplayer implementation of resistance game
games multiplayer multiplayer-browser-game multiplayer-game multiplayer-online-game nextjs nodejs react reactjs socket-io
Last synced: 18 Jan 2025
https://github.com/francislagares/jobber-app
A Full Stack Freelance Marketplace application built using the MERN stack ( MongoDB, Express.js, React, and Node.js ) and a microservices architecture. The platform facilitates connections between freelancers and clients, allowing users to post projects, bid on jobs, and manage transactions.
docker elasticsearch express kubernetes microservices mongodb nodejs rabbitmq reactjs redis-cache redux-toolkit socket-io
Last synced: 29 Jan 2025
https://github.com/gitusergb/kaseahat
A real-time messaging application built with the MERN stack, featuring seamless chat, user authentication, and dynamic updates
mongodb nodejs reactjs socket-io
Last synced: 30 Jan 2025
https://github.com/hyperlink/socket.io-sticky-headers
Use custom header to maintain sticky sessions with socket.io
Last synced: 24 Jan 2025
https://github.com/codecraft26/sketch-book
SketchPad Pro is a dynamic and interactive online sketchbook that brings your creativity to life through the power of Socket.IO and the Canvas API. Unleash your artistic potential and connect with others in real-time, as you craft, collaborate, and share.
canvas frontend nextjs socket-io
Last synced: 11 Jan 2025
https://github.com/msusman1/webrtc-server
WebRTC Signaling server Implemented using Nodejs Socket io
socket-io webrtc webrtc-signaling webrtc-video websocket
Last synced: 30 Jan 2025
https://github.com/marcosmarcolin/async-php
Exemplos básicos de PHP Assíncrono com Workerman, Ratchet, Swoole, etc.
asynchronous-programming ixcsoft php ratchet socket-io swoole websocket workerman
Last synced: 30 Jan 2025
https://github.com/mujtabamohamed/chat-wave
ChatWave is a real-time chat application that allows users to communicate instantly. The project is built with a modern tech stack to ensure a responsive and interactive user experience.
backend bcrypt chat-application expressjs frontend full-stack mern mongodb nodejs react reactjs real-time realtime-chat socket-io tailwindcss
Last synced: 31 Dec 2024
https://github.com/ejiroosiephri/multiplayer-pong-game
Simple Multiplayer game that makes use of the socket.io library logic to perform multiple requests on multiple client
expressjs nodejs socket-io websocket
Last synced: 11 Jan 2025
https://github.com/mohammed1medhat/clinicy
Api for an doctor reservation app made in rest architecture with js
booking-platform express-js jwt-authentication monogodb socket-io ws
Last synced: 11 Jan 2025
https://github.com/andriannus/library-vue
Simple library app with MEVN Stack (Vue - TypeScript)
express javascript socket-io typescript vue
Last synced: 10 Jan 2025
https://github.com/mhsnbakhshi/uniqueroom
UniqueRoom RealTime Chat App with Socket.io & Typescript
express mongodb mongoose redis socket-io typescript
Last synced: 10 Jan 2025
https://github.com/samarth-5/social-hub
Social Hub is a real-time messaging platform where users can log in and instantly send and receive messages between two users across different systems and locations. It ensures seamless and immediate communication for a connected experience.
daisy-ui javascript mongodb nodejs reactjs socket-io sockets web-sockets zustand
Last synced: 21 Jan 2025
https://github.com/radekxrandom/obiadekchat
[Unmaintained] Encrypted chat with many features
Last synced: 09 Feb 2025
https://github.com/naihe138/small-talk
一款基于socket.io高颜值的聊天app(A chat app based on socket.io)
koa2 mongodb mongose react react-create-app socket-io
Last synced: 22 Jan 2025
https://github.com/anurag-327/chat-app
Chat App built using react, express, socket.io and mongodb
nodejs react socket-io tailwindcss
Last synced: 30 Jan 2025
https://github.com/spacesick/socketio-messaging
Simple real-time chatting with Node.js, Socket.io, and Prisma.
Last synced: 09 Jan 2025
https://github.com/sammwyy/online-chat
Example of Real-time chat built on Socket.io and Node.js
babel chat chat-application ejs nodejs realtime socket-io
Last synced: 17 Jan 2025
https://github.com/juliencrn/chat
Simple chat application to learn backend dev using JavaScript.
docker lerna mongodb nestjs react-router reactjs redux socket-io tailwindcss typescript
Last synced: 07 Feb 2025
https://github.com/vedanthb/awobbi
aWobbi is a social media application built with React/Babel (Client), Redux Toolkit for state management, Tailwind CSS for styling, Node(API) and MongoDb for DB. Auto formatted with Prettier, linted with ESLint.
Last synced: 01 Jan 2025
https://github.com/ravindramohith/discord-clone
Discord Clone built with Next.js v13, Socket.io, ReactJS, TailwindCSS, Prisma, and MySQL, featuring real-time communication, custom channels, and responsive design
aws-ec2 cicd cicdpipeline docker fullstack-development githubactions mysql nextjs13 prisma reactjs socket-io tailwindcss yaml
Last synced: 10 Jan 2025
https://github.com/dvir-cohen1/xogame
Tic-Tac-Toe - React.js & Socket.io
express nodejs reactjs socket-io
Last synced: 19 Dec 2024
https://github.com/smhussain5/flask-socketio-chat-python
Full-stack real-time chat application Python/PyCharm, Flask, SocketIO, JavaScript
chat-application flask flask-socketio javascript pycharm python socket-io
Last synced: 19 Dec 2024
https://github.com/shahaf-f-s/socketsio
A python wrapper around socket for generalized communication protocols, unified socket interface, utility methods, and modular protocol swapping capeabilities. Including a socket based Pub/Sub system.
pubsub socket socket-io socket-programming
Last synced: 19 Dec 2024
https://github.com/nishantdecode/isleverse-fe
IsleVerse is a real-time communication platform built with Next.js, leveraging WebRTC, WebSockets, and peer-to-peer communication for seamless video calling.
nextjs peer-to-peer peerjs radix-ui reactjs shadcn-ui socket-io webrtc websocket
Last synced: 23 Dec 2024
https://github.com/shimul-zahan/mvc-client
A responsive, real-time chat application frontend built with React.js and Socket.IO. Features secure authentication, instant messaging, media sharing, notifications, and dark mode. Designed with reusable components and efficient state management for scalability and seamless user experience.
audio-call chatting-app mongodb mongoose nodejs reactjs realtime-chat redux redux-toolkit socket-io video-call webrtc
Last synced: 12 Jan 2025
https://github.com/moumen-soliman/nodejs-chat
Simple chat application, you can create chat room with join more than one user and multiple rooms in same time with secure data in one room and authentication for users with mongodb , you can follow what happening in console.
authentication javascript momentjs mongodb mongodb-database mongoosejs mustache-js node node-js nodejs npm socket-io socket-io-client ui-components
Last synced: 19 Jan 2025
https://github.com/nkg447/chokdi
A card game. Played between 4 players
card-game express javascript js js-game players react socket-io
Last synced: 16 Jan 2025
https://github.com/icyjoseph/home-iot
IoT Project combining Arduino, Raspberry, SocketIO and React
arduino johnny-five raspberry-pi react socket-io
Last synced: 21 Jan 2025
https://github.com/iwolf22/are-you-a-hotty-then-cool-down-your-body
Hottie Cooler is a smart fan made for Jam Hacks 7 created with an Arduino connected to a NodeJS server via Socket.io
arduino css html javascript node-js socket-io
Last synced: 12 Jan 2025
https://github.com/arden-rh/kill-the-hoff
A game where you play against another player to see who can "kill" the hoff quickest by reaction time. Using sockets and a database in MongoDB (no longer active).
api express group-project heroku html mongodb nosql nosql-database prisma school-assignment school-project scss socket-io typescript
Last synced: 12 Jan 2025
https://github.com/algab/storage-web
Storage Files application web interface.
Last synced: 12 Jan 2025
https://github.com/root-kings/template-express
Fully configured, modular starter template for Express-MongoDB API
express mongodb mongoose socket-io
Last synced: 30 Jan 2025
https://github.com/rhannachi/docker-roadmap
Roadmap for All Things Docker, docker-compose, docker swarm
docker docker-compose docker-machine docker-swarm express javascript nodejs portainer rabbitmq react socket-io swarm
Last synced: 12 Jan 2025
https://github.com/practical-works/mevn-chat
💬 Realtime chat web app example made with the MEVN stack (MongoDB, ExpressJS, VueJS, and NodeJS).
chat chat-app chat-application express expressjs javascript messenger mevn mevn-stack mongo mongodb mongoose node nodejs realtime realtime-messaging socket socket-io vue vuejs
Last synced: 24 Dec 2024
https://github.com/dangdungcntt/chatchit-mongodb
Chat real-time
config ejs expressjs jshint jwt-authentication mongoose nodejs socket-io yarn
Last synced: 18 Jan 2025
https://github.com/anmol372005/instantconnect-real-time-chat-application
This RealEstate website is an online platform that enables users to rent houses and apartments for personal or business use. The website provides an intuitive user interface for searching, comparing and reserving properties.
authentication expressjs mern-stack mongodb nodejs reactjs socket-io
Last synced: 19 Dec 2024
https://github.com/hotslab/thecontinentalrestaurant
The Continental Restaurant's booking manager provides the best service to the world's finest citizens, built with Vue and Koajs.
cypress docker docker-compose koa-boilerplate koa2 koajs microservices mongodb node-cron nodejs quasar-framework redis socket-io typescript vue vuejs
Last synced: 01 Feb 2025
https://github.com/cenga93/pizza-order-tracker
Realtime pizza order tracker app using NodeJs, Express and Mongo DB
bootstrap5 ejs-templates exprees express-middleware express-session express-validator gulp javascript mongodb nodejs realtime scss socket-io websocket
Last synced: 01 Feb 2025
https://github.com/mateusfg7/pychat
A simple chat made with python and sockets
chat python3 socket-io sockets
Last synced: 01 Feb 2025
https://github.com/nachotoast/spotifyquiz
How well do you know your Spotify playlists?
express nodejs react socket-io spotify-web-api typescript
Last synced: 08 Feb 2025
https://github.com/cdqwertz/game_4
A game
canvas-game game html5 multiplayer-game nodejs socket-io topdown tower-defense
Last synced: 08 Feb 2025
https://github.com/craiggleso/webrtc-socket
Uses Websockets to send WebRTC data to and from users
socket-io webrtc webrtc-data websockets
Last synced: 08 Feb 2025
https://github.com/meharsulaiman/discord-clone
Discord but with our own set of tools
clerk nextjs prisma reacthookform shadcn-ui socket-io uploadthi zod zustand
Last synced: 08 Feb 2025
https://github.com/aseyed/ciphersocket
authentication client-server nodejs socket-io socket-programming
Last synced: 08 Feb 2025
https://github.com/chef-js/socket
Command Line Interface Static Files Server written in TypeScript for Single Page Applications serving in Node with Socket.IO
cli express http-server javascript nodejs nodejs-server socket-io typescript websockets
Last synced: 08 Feb 2025
https://github.com/ramji023/realtimechat_application
css html javascript nodejs socket-io
Last synced: 08 Feb 2025
https://github.com/eugenehlushko/game-15
Play famous "15" game with react and websockets, chat, highscores
express game react react-redux reactjs socket-io
Last synced: 08 Feb 2025
https://github.com/kiblelab/quoridouble-portfolio
강화학습 기반 AI와 PvP 대전, 개선된 UX가 구현된 Quoridor 게임 앱 Resources
cmake cpp dart flutter gradle java socket-io spring-boot
Last synced: 08 Feb 2025
https://github.com/orang-utan/ts-canvas
A collaborative online drawing canvas using TypeScript, Socket.io, and SSE's
express expressjs heroku mongoose socket-io typescript
Last synced: 08 Feb 2025
https://github.com/theemperorofdaiviet/socket.io-chat-example
A basic chat application to get started with Socket.IO
chat-app css3 expressjs html5 javascript nodejs realtime socket-io websocket
Last synced: 08 Feb 2025
https://github.com/miguelamello/python-fleet-logbook
This is an implementation of a Fleet Logbook Service responsible for receiving, collecting, processing and presenting data from "VDR - Vessel Data Recorders" and making it available for further analysis or storage.
api-gateway dashboard flask graphql microservices mongodb python socket-io software-engineering
Last synced: 08 Feb 2025
https://github.com/touseefelahi/communication
Simple Socket programing utility
asynchronous-programming broadcast socket-io socket-programming sockets tcp udp
Last synced: 08 Feb 2025
https://github.com/bayajidalam/matt-mons-server
It's a multi vendor e-commerce website backend
bycrypt docker e-commerce e2e-testing express-js integration-testing jest jwt node-js postgresql prisma socket-io stripe-payment supertest typescript unit-testing zod
Last synced: 08 Feb 2025
https://github.com/kisiwu/novice-socket
A way of building server side socket.io applications.
Last synced: 08 Feb 2025
https://github.com/sangqle/node-app-chat
The app chat realtime with web socket without any database
nodejs prisma real-time socket-io
Last synced: 08 Feb 2025
https://github.com/bbpezsgo/wschat
📨 A very simple chat with WebSocket and Node.js
Last synced: 08 Feb 2025